This uses PostScript Colour Rendering Dictionaries built-in to the
printer, and affects both RGB and CMYK data.
Rendering Intents
When a document is printed, a conversion takes place from the
document's colour space to the printer colour space. The
rendering intents (1) are essentially a set of rules that determine
how this colour conversion takes place.
The rendering intents provided are listed below:
Perceptual
Best choice for printing photographs. Compresses the source
gamut into the printer's gamut whilst maintaining the overall
appearance of an image. This may change the overall
appearance of an image as all the colours are shifted together.
Saturation
Best choice for printing bright & saturated colours if you don't
necessarily care how accurate the colours are. This makes it
the recommended choice for graphs, charts, diagrams etc.
Maps fully saturated colours in the source gamut to fully
saturated colours in the printer's gamut.
